Meshless method is one of the current in numerical analysis by far at home and abroad. Because the meshless method is not limited by the traditional elements and meshes, it is applied widely. But the boundary condition introduction difficultly has the limitation to its development, how to solves this problem is appear especially important.The paper systematically introduces present development of Meshless Method and the basic theory of EFGM, and mainly describes the equation by which the Moving Least Square (MLS) is approximately used to deduce EFGM, meanwhile, introduce singular weight function concept, and discusses the factors which may effect the calculation precision and, Has established the singular weight function of meshless method procedure with Matlab. Through to many typical example computation solution and the exact solution contrast. The accuracy and a the precision of the proceduce are conformed.This method not only is effective in solves in the meshless boundary condition introduction.,but also feasible in practice.For the structural engineering, the constitutive relations of concrete members under the strength will be nonlinear or elasticoplastic, the Concrete retaining wall is analyzed by using nonlinear singular weight function EFGM, the calculation result by nonlinear singular weight function EFGM is compared with the software ANSYS, the comparison proves that singular weight function of EFGM used to solve the concrete nonlinear problem is feasible. For the treatment of steel bar in concrete, the local dispersion model is proposed, with the model steel bar is dispersed in a local field ,the article is applied it in singular weight function of Element Free Garlekin Method (EFGM),and has established the singular weight function meshless method procedure with Matlab, the calculation result by singular weight function EFGM is compared with the software of ANSYS, the comparison proves that singular weight function of EFGM is feasible.
